Austin Seferian-Jenkins to be integral part of Jaguars' offense

Jacksonville Jaguars tight end Austin Seferian-Jenkins will be an "integral" part of the team's offense, Jaguars.com expects.

What It Means:

ASJ has shown a strong "work ethic and approach," and has "appeared in sync with Blake Bortles." He averaged just 7.1 yards per catch in last year's comeback season, but the team paid him $4 million guaranteed, an indication they do indeed have plans for him.

Our models project Seferian-Jenkins for 459 receiving yards and 3.6 touchdowns on 47 catches this year, the 21st-best fantasy projections among tight ends.
